One of the streets in Belgrade was named "Tashkent"

The next event within the framework of the official visit of the President of the Republic of Uzbekistan Shavkat Mirziyoyev to Serbia was the ceremony of naming one of the streets in Belgrade "Tashkent".

The leaders emphasized that this decision testifies to the rapidly developing multifaceted relations between Uzbekistan and Serbia, which have reached the level of strategic partnership today.

Confidence was expressed that Tashkent Street would become a bright symbol of the firm commitment to further strengthening the bonds of friendship and kindness between our peoples.
